MANUALE PYTHON

MANUALE PYTHON

Il prezzo originale era: 21,99 €.Il prezzo attuale รจ: 9,99 €.

Il Manuale Python รจ una guida completa e dettagliata alla programmazione in Python, sviluppata con l’ausilio dell’intelligenza artificiale. Con 128 pagine ricche di contenuti, il manuale affronta tutti gli aspetti fondamentali e avanzati del linguaggio, tra cui installazione, tipi di dati, strutture di controllo, programmazione orientata agli oggetti, gestione dei file, eccezioni e concetti avanzati come generatori e metaclassi. Include inoltre esercitazioni pratiche, laboratori e applicazioni reali come chatbot e integrazione con API. Perfetto per principianti ed esperti che vogliono approfondire il linguaggio Python.

Descrizione

Manuale Python

Il Manuale Python รจ una guida esaustiva alla programmazione con Python, strutturata in modo chiaro e dettagliato per coprire sia le basi del linguaggio sia gli aspetti avanzati. Il manuale รจ diviso nei seguenti capitoli:

  1. Introduzione agli Elaboratori
    • Architettura di un Elaboratore
    • La CPU e il suo ruolo
    • I BUS e la comunicazione tra componenti
    • La Memoria RAM e il salvataggio temporaneo
    • Ciclo di esecuzione delle istruzioni (esempio pratico con 5 + 8)
    • La Macchina di Von Neumann
    • Come il Software interagisce con l’Hardware
  2. Installazione di Python
    • Installare Python su Windows
    • Installare Python su macOS
    • Installare Python su Linux
    • Configurare lโ€™Ambiente di Sviluppo (IDE e Editor di Testo)
    • Verifica dellโ€™Installazione e Introduzione alla CLI di Python
    • Configurazione delle Variabili di Ambiente
  3. Concetti Fondamentali
    • Introduzione a Python
    • Sistemi di Numerazione (Decimale, Binario, Ottale, Esadecimale)
    • Operazioni Logiche (AND, OR, NOT, XOR)
    • Conversione tra Sistemi Numerici
    • Introduzione alla Python Virtual Machine
  4. Tipi di Dati e Strutture di Base
    • Tipi di Dati Numerici e Operazioni
    • Stringhe e Manipolazione Testuale
    • Liste, Tuple, e Dizionari
    • Bytes e Bytearray
    • Tipi di Dati Composti e Conversioni
  5. Strutture di Controllo
    • If, While, e For
    • Funzione range e Cicli
    • List, Dict e Set Comprehensions
  6. Funzioni e Moduli
    • Definizione di Funzioni
    • Decoratori e Funzioni Lambda
    • Namespace e Scope
    • Utilizzo di Moduli e Pacchetti
    • Funzioni Speciali come __str__, __repr__, e __dict__
  7. Programmazione Orientata agli Oggetti
    • Classi e Oggetti
    • Costruttori (__init__ e __new__)
    • Metodi di Classe e Statici
    • Ereditarietร  e Polimorfismo
    • Metodi Magici e Slots
    • Decoratori di Classe e Proprietร 
  8. Concetti Avanzati
    • Generators e Iteratori
    • Metaclassi e MRO (Method Resolution Order)
    • Classi Astratte
    • Enumerazioni (Enum)
    • Classi Object e Type
  9. Gestione dei File
    • Apertura e Chiusura dei File
    • Lettura e Scrittura di File
    • Encoding e Decoding
    • Context Manager (with)
    • Metodi read, write, readline, seek e tell
  10. Ambiente di Lavoro
    • Virtual Environment in Python
    • Versioning e Gestione delle Dipendenze
  11. Gestione delle Eccezioni
    • Blocco try/except
    • Clausole else e finally
    • Istruzioni raise e assert
    • Eccezioni Personalizzate
  12. Applicazioni Pratiche
    • Creazione di Chat con OpenAI e ChatGPT
    • Utilizzo delle API di OpenAI
    • Progetti Applicativi ed Esercitazioni
  13. Esercitazioni e Laboratori
    • Esercitazioni su Argomenti Specifici
    • Laboratori Avanzati su Progetti Realistici

Recensioni

Ancora non ci sono recensioni.

Solamente clienti che hanno effettuato l'accesso ed hanno acquistato questo prodotto possono lasciare una recensione.

Torna in cima